Модераторы: Aliance, skyboy, MoLeX, ksnk
  

Поиск:

Ответ в темуСоздание новой темы Создание опроса
> curl и caйт на asp.net, пропадает авторизация 
:(
    Опции темы
fake2
Дата 16.2.2011, 19:49 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Новичок



Профиль
Группа: Участник
Сообщений: 25
Регистрация: 17.5.2010

Репутация: нет
Всего: нет



захожу на сайт, хожу норм. по ссылкам, а на открытии формы, которая нужна вылетаю - пропадает авторизация. hidden поля при открытии формы не передаются, рефер норм,  все куки на месте. куда копать?
PM MAIL   Вверх
patap
Дата 17.2.2011, 10:23 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Опытный
**


Профиль
Группа: Участник
Сообщений: 893
Регистрация: 7.5.2005
Где: Украина, Зп

Репутация: нет
Всего: 40



взглянуть бы.., может каких-то заголовков не хватает, или чего-то ты пропустил


--------------------
На боку кобура болталась, сзади шашка отцовская звякала. 
Впереди меня все хохотало, а позади все плакало (с)
PM MAIL ICQ   Вверх
fake2
Дата 17.2.2011, 16:54 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Новичок



Профиль
Группа: Участник
Сообщений: 25
Регистрация: 17.5.2010

Репутация: нет
Всего: нет



эту функцию неверно вызывал.
Код

    public function send_curl($post=true, $reffer=true, $send_cookie=true)
    {
        $this->_ch = curl_init();
        curl_setopt($this->_ch, CURLOPT_URL, $this->_url);
        curl_setopt($this->_ch, CURLOPT_USERAGENT, $this->_agent);
   //     curl_setopt($this->_ch, CURLOPT_COOKIESESSION, true);
        if ($send_cookie)
        {
            curl_setopt($this->_ch, CURLOPT_COOKIEFILE, $this->_cookie);
        }
        if ($reffer)
        {
            curl_setopt($this->_ch, CURLOPT_REFERER, $this->_reffer);
        }
        if ($post)
        {
            curl_setopt($this->_ch, CURLOPT_POST, 1);
            curl_setopt($this->_ch, CURLOPT_POSTFIELDS, $this->_post);
        }
        else
        {
            curl_setopt($this->_ch, CURLOPT_POST, 0);
        }
        curl_setopt($this->_ch, CURLOPT_RETURNTRANSFER, 1);
        curl_setopt($this->_ch, CURLOPT_FOLLOWLOCATION, 1);
        curl_setopt($this->_ch, CURLOPT_COOKIEJAR, $this->_cookie);
        $this->_html = curl_exec($this->_ch);
        curl_close($this->_ch);
    }
хотя и сейчас работает через раз. то вылетаю то нет.
PM MAIL   Вверх
  
Ответ в темуСоздание новой темы Создание опроса
0 Пользователей читают эту тему (0 Гостей и 0 Скрытых Пользователей)
0 Пользователей:
« Предыдущая тема | PHP: Сеть | Следующая тема »


 




[ Время генерации скрипта: 0.0870 ]   [ Использовано запросов: 22 ]   [ GZIP включён ]


Реклама на сайте     Информационное спонсорство

 
По вопросам размещения рекламы пишите на vladimir(sobaka)vingrad.ru
Отказ от ответственности     Powered by Invision Power Board(R) 1.3 © 2003  IPS, Inc.